The Packers have claimed James Turner off waivers, adding another participant to their kicking competition. Turner, 23, recently joined the league as an undrafted free agent after a year with the Lions. Prior to his time with the Wolverines, Turner kicked for Louisville between 2019-2022. In 2023, he made 18-of-21 field goal attempts and set a single-season record at Michigan with 65 successful PATs.
